The process for acquiring these packs is streamlined through the Autodesk Account portal . Users can navigate to their "Products and Services," view the details for AutoCAD 2016, and download the specific language pack required. Once installed, the language pack integrates seamlessly with the existing software, creating a unique "Language-Specific" shortcut on the desktop.
